Transaction 62feda477f57b72ed1d7855f66b2648be35a55378276644d335882269804c2c3
1 Input
1 Output
-
62feda477f57b72ed1d7855f66b2648be35a55378276644d335882269804c2c3:0
- value
- 12622956
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8268773d7a1bd8f8f46a0ee90914d7e3ff639fbf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CtXzMAk2T6J5uXRGQ47PDSa9qsQNAoNKY